How to Build Momentum Immediately
Stop waiting. Start doing. Here are five practical steps to ignite momentum today:
1. Pick One Small, Clear Action and Do It Now
Forget overwhelming to-do lists. Choose one specific task that moves you closer to your goal. It can be as simple as writing one paragraph, making one call, or doing a 5-minute workout. The key is to act immediately. This breaks the paralysis of overthinking and creates your first spark.
2. Set a Timer and Work in Short Bursts
Discipline doesn’t mean grinding endlessly. Use a timer for 25 minutes of focused work (Pomodoro technique). When the timer ends, take a 5-minute break. This builds a rhythm and keeps your brain sharp. Momentum grows when you create consistent, manageable work cycles.
3. Track Your Progress Visibly
Write down what you accomplish each day. Seeing your wins, no matter how small, fuels motivation and accountability. Use a journal, app, or whiteboard. This visual proof of progress makes it harder to quit and easier to push forward.
4. Remove One Distraction Right Now
Identify what’s stealing your focus—phone, social media, clutter—and eliminate it. Create a workspace that supports your goals. Momentum dies in chaos and distraction. Clear your environment to clear your mind.
5. Commit Publicly or to Someone You Trust
Tell a friend, family member, or coach what you’re doing and when you’ll do it. Accountability is a powerful motivator. When someone else expects you to act, you’re more likely to follow through and keep momentum alive.

Shift Your Mindset to Own Your Momentum
Momentum is not just about what you do; it’s about who you become. To build unstoppable momentum, you must change your identity, discipline, and environment.
Own Your Identity
Stop thinking of yourself as someone who procrastinates or fails to follow through. Start seeing yourself as a doer, a person who takes action no matter what. Your identity shapes your habits. When you believe you are unstoppable, your actions will reflect that.
Build Discipline Like a Muscle
Discipline is the bridge between goals and results. It’s not about motivation or inspiration—it’s about showing up every day and doing the work. Treat discipline like training a muscle: start small, be consistent, and grow stronger over time.
Design Your Environment for Success
Your surroundings influence your behavior more than you realize. Create an environment that supports your momentum. That means decluttering, setting up reminders, and surrounding yourself with people who push you forward. If you don’t, your environment will drag you back into old habits.
